1.6 million eggs recalled at Kroger and other stores over salmonella risk, FDA says

Midwest Poultry Services is recalling 1.6 million eggs over concerns that they could be contaminated with salmonella, the Food and Drug Administration said Wednesday.  The recall covers white-shell and cage-free shell eggs produced at the company’s Texas farms and distributed to retailers in six states. DOJ sues 2 Chinese companies over immersion water heaters that can burst into flames “within minutes”

The Justice Department is suing two Chinese companies to force a mandatory recall of immersion water heaters, alleging that the products can overheat and catch fire “within minutes” after they’re turned on, according to court filings obtained by CBS News. Antihistamine recall across the U.S. triggered by heartburn drug contamination risk, FDA says

A generic version of the brand-name allergy medication Zyrtec is under recall across the U.S. due to potential cross-contamination with a heartburn drug, according to the Food and Drug Administration.  Drugmaker Unique Pharmaceutical Laboratories is voluntarily recalling antihistamine drugs, commonly used to treat seasonal allergies, over potential cross-contamination with ranitidine, a heartburn drug.
